From f15a72e89d5b708df9b20753d6ba7de7581ebf50 Mon Sep 17 00:00:00 2001 From: PrivacyDev Date: Thu, 13 Jul 2023 23:22:02 -0400 Subject: [PATCH] fixed empty tweet author headers --- src/parser.nim |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/parser.nim b/src/parser.nim index 6e6499d..a02c2d6 100644 --- a/src/parser.nim +++ b/src/parser.nim @@ -29,7 +29,11 @@ proc parseUser(js: JsonNode; id=""): User = result.expandUserEntities(js) proc parseGraphUser(js: JsonNode): User = - let user = ? js{"user_results", "result"} + var user: JsonNode + if "user_result" in js: + user = ? js{"user_result", "result"} + else: + user = ? js{"user_results", "result"} result = parseUser(user{"legacy"}) if "is_blue_verified" in user: